One of the greatest colorists of his generation, Howard Hodgkin explores the very nature of painting as both cultured language and sheer expression. He disregards the classical polarities of abstraction and representation, past and present, canvas and frame, using gestural brushstrokes and a vivid palette to emphasize the picture plane, while simultaneously seeking to convey memories and emotions. The seemingly casual, urgent quality of his paintings and prints belies a drawn-out process of making: it could take a year for Hodgkin to prepare to execute a single brushstroke. The resultant maximalist, saturated works on canvas, paper, wood and board can be intimately scaled and jewel-like, or oversized, opulent and theatrical. Whilst his early compositions have a collaged, geometric flatness, Hodgkin's later work (including etching and aquatint prints) increasingly incorporated more lush surface textures and complex, fluid patterns reminiscent of the Paturi miniatures from India, of which he was an avid collector.Sir Howard Hodgkin was born in 1932 in England, and has spent most of his working career producing colourist paintings and prints that have captured the art world's love and imagination. Hodgkin's works hang somewhere in between abstract and figurative. They're difficult to categorise but the main characteristics include his use of powerful strong colours, applied from a heavily loaded wide brush; he creates pictures that are of emotions, objects, landscapes and intangible subjects. His canvases are framed during their creation and this allows Hodgkin's paintbrush to extend onto the frame, creating a sort of proscenium arch before the stage. He says of his art that he paints' representational pictures of emotional situations'.
As one of Britain's leading artists, Hodgkin's work has attracted international acclaim and new young audiences. He represented Britain at the XLI Venice Biennale in 1984. He has been a Trustee of both the Tate Gallery (1970-76) and National Gallery (1978-85) in London.He was awarded the prestigious Turner Prize in 1985 and was knighted in 1992. His work is in the collection of museums and galleries throughout the world, including the Metropolitan Museum of Art, NY, the São Paulo Museum, the National Gallery of Art Washington D.

Hodgkin has produced about 130 editions of striking and beautifully crafted prints which range in size from the very small to huge. This long-awaited exhibition will finally provide the opportunity for a full appraisal of Hodgkin's works in print.This artist's creative process is one of finding an image, and the means of its expression, through action. Hodgkin has broken many of the rules of the craft, and the results are among the most stunning effects of color and surface in contemporary printmaking. He constantly re-invents his personal language of marks, often developing compositions from spatial and formal observations, using form and colour to communicate pure aesthetic emotion. Howard Hodgkin died March 9, 2017 in London, England. Howard Hodgkin: The Artists He Painted.
